In the Philippines, the agency responsible for Disaster Prevention and Mitigation is the ____.

Department of Science and Technology (DOST)

2
New cards

The main objective of Disaster Response is to .

preserve life and meet basic needs

3
New cards

The legal basis for the DRRM system in the Philippines is ____.

Republic Act 10121

4
New cards

The lead agency for the Disaster Preparedness thematic area is the ___.

Department of the Interior and Local Government (DILG)

5
New cards

____ of the Local DRRM Fund is allocated for the Quick Response Fund.

Thirty percent (30%)

6
New cards

The agency that manages the Rehabilitation and Recovery thematic area is ____.

National Economic and Development Authority (NEDA)
